News Hope Davis Set for Upcoming Movie, "The Family Tree" Tony Award nominee Hope Davis will star in the new movie "The Family Tree," which will have a theatrical release in New York and Los Angeles Aug. 26, according to Variety.

The film will then be distributed by Entertainment One via digital stream, home video, video on demand and television.

"The Family Tree," directed by Vivi Friedman with a script by Mark Lisson, focuses on the dysfunctional Burnett family. Davis stars opposite Dermot Mulroney ("My Best Friend's Wedding") as the mother of the family, Bunnie Burnett, who was injured in a freak accident and left with a case of amnesia giving the family an unexpected second chance at happiness.

The cast also features Max Thieriot, Brittany Robertson and Chi McBride, and is produced by Allan Jones, J. Todd Harris, Mark Lisson and Kathy Weiss.

Davis was nominated for a Tony for her performance in God of Carnage and has also been seen on Broadway in Ivanov and Two Shakespearean Actors.
